>

C++ array index - Select the Index Card 3″ x 5″ option in Microsoft Word if you want

May 17, 2021 · 函数说明:rindex ()用来找出参

I'm having a brain fart at the moment and I am looking for a fast way to take an array and pass half of it to a function. If I had an array A of ten elements, in some languages I could pass something like A[5:] to the function and be done with it. Is there a similar construct in c++? Obviously I'd like to avoid and sort of looping function.How Linear Search Works? The following steps are followed to search for an element k = 1 in the list below.. Array to be searched for. Start from the first element, compare k with each element x. Compare with each elementExceeding the bounds of the array means that you would be accessing memory that is not assigned to the array. This means: This memory can have any value. There's no way of knowing if the data is valid based on your data type. This memory may contain sensitive information such as private keys or other user credentials.4. C or C++ will not check the bounds of an array access. You are allocating the array on the stack. Indexing the array via array [3] is equivalent to * (array + 3), where array is a pointer to &array [0]. This will result in undefined behavior.12 Answers Sorted by: 15 Youre simply getting a pointer that contains the address of that "imaginary" location, i.e. the location of the first element &realarray [0] minus the size of one element. This is undefined behavior, and might break horribly if, for instance, your machine has a segmented memory architecture.Arrays in C act to store related data under a single variable name with an index, also known as a subscript. It is easiest to think of an array as simply a list or ordered grouping for variables of the same type. As such, arrays often help a programmer organize collections of data efficiently and intuitively.It’s safe to say that every investor knows about, or at the very least has heard of, the Dow Jones U.S. Index. It is an important tool that reflects activity in the U.S. stock market and can be a key indicator for consumers who are paying a...Learn C++ Tutorial ... Arrays Loop Through an Array Multidimensional Arrays. Java Methods ... An int value, representing the index of the first occurrence of the character in the string, or -1 if it never occurs: More Examples. Example.The number is known as an array index. We can access elements of an array by using those indices. // syntax to access array elements array[index]; Consider the array x we have seen above. Elements of an array in C++ Few Things to Remember: The array indices start with 0. Meaning x[0] is the first element stored at index 0. If the size of an ...A typical declaration for an array in C++ is: type name [elements]; where typeis a valid type (such as int, float...), nameis a valid identifier and the elementsfield (which is always …Sort (Array, Array, Int32, Int32, IComparer) Sorts a range of elements in a pair of one-dimensional Array objects (one contains the keys and the other contains the corresponding items) based on the keys in the first Array using the specified IComparer. Sort (Array, Int32, Int32, IComparer) Sorts the elements in a range of elements in a one ...Quote from the C standard, (C18), 6.3.2.1/4: "Except when it is the operand of the sizeof operator, or the unary & operator, or is a string literal used to initialize an array, an expression that has type "array of type" is converted to an expression with type "pointer to type" that points to the initial element of the array object and is not an lvalue.// syntax to access array elements array[index]; Consider the array x we have seen above. Elements of an array in C++ Few Things to Remember: The array indices start with 0. Meaning x [0] is the first element stored at index 0. If the size of an array is n, the last element is stored at index (n-1). In this example, x [5] is the last element.Sep 1, 2016 · Aconcagua's edit is correct; the user is collecting array indicies, not the array elements themselves. Now, I don't quite understand what the moderator says - "the user is collecting array indicies". The way I see it, an index is the location of an element within an array. For example, in the C language: Array index in your context (array bound is not known) is exactly identical to the pointer operation. From a viewpoint of compilers, it is just different expression of pointer arithmetic. Here is an example of an optimized x86 code in Visual Studio 2010 with full optimization and no inline.How Linear Search Works? The following steps are followed to search for an element k = 1 in the list below.. Array to be searched for. Start from the first element, compare k with each element x. Compare with each elementarray. circular-list. or ask your own question. The problem: Treat an array as if it is circular; out-of-bounds indices "wrap around" the array to become in-bounds. Current solution: // roudedArray.cpp #include <iostream> template <.Therefore, objects of type array<Ty, N> can be initialized by using an aggregate initializer. For example, C++. array<int, 4> ai = { 1, 2, 3 }; creates the object ai that holds four integer values, initializes the first three elements to the values 1, 2, and 3, respectively, and initializes the fourth element to 0.1. I was reading through a C program which interfaces with hardware registers. The person has been using hexadecimal numbers as the index to an array such as : app_base_add [0x30] I know that a [i] means * (a+i) which is * (a+ (i*sizeof ( typeof (a)))) so a hexadecimal index is probably a offset of the desired memory location in the address ...In the academic and research community, getting published in reputable journals is crucial for sharing knowledge, gaining recognition, and advancing one’s career. Scopus also considers the timeliness and regularity with which journals publi...12 Answers Sorted by: 15 Youre simply getting a pointer that contains the address of that "imaginary" location, i.e. the location of the first element &realarray [0] minus the size of one element. This is undefined behavior, and might break horribly if, for instance, your machine has a segmented memory architecture.C Multidimensional Arrays. In C programming, you can create an array of arrays. These arrays are known as multidimensional arrays. For example, Here, x is a two-dimensional (2d) array. The array can hold 12 elements. You can think the array as a table with 3 rows and each row has 4 columns. Similarly, you can declare a three-dimensional (3d) array.c++ - How do I find a particular value in an array and return its index? - Stack Overflow How do I find a particular value in an array and return its index? Ask Question Asked 13 years ago Modified 8 months ago Viewed 176k times 27 Pseudo Code: int arr [ 5 ] = { 4, 1, 3, 2, 6 }, x; x = find (3).arr ; x would then return 2. c++ arrays ShareSelect the Index Card 3″ x 5″ option in Microsoft Word if you want to create an index card. After determining the size, you may type, insert photos and edit the index card area as needed.Learn how to replace an item at a specific index in a C++ array with a 0. This tutorial provides a C++ function that takes an array of integers and an index ...In array, we use an integer value called index to refer at any element of array. Array index starts from 0 and goes till N - 1 (where N is size of the array). In above case array index ranges from 0 to 4. To access individual array element we use array variable name with index enclosed within square brackets [and ].Creating and Filling an Array. To create an array, define it like this: TArray<int32> IntArray; This creates an empty array designed to hold a sequence of integers. The element type can be any value type that is copyable and destructible according to normal C++ value rules, like int32, FString, TSharedPtr, and so on.Three Dimensional Array; Two-Dimensional Array in C. A two-dimensional array or 2D array in C is the simplest form of the multidimensional array. We can visualize a two-dimensional array as an array of one-dimensional arrays arranged one over another forming a table with ‘x’ rows and ‘y’ columns where the row number ranges from 0 to (x ...Then, an array indexing will be from 0 to 3, i.e., we can access elements from index 0 to 3. But, if we use index which is greater than 3, it will be called as an index out of bounds. If, we use an array index which is out of bounds, then the compiler will compile and even run. But, there is no guarantee for the correct result.c++ - How do I find a particular value in an array and return its index? - Stack Overflow How do I find a particular value in an array and return its index? Ask Question Asked 13 years ago Modified 8 months ago Viewed 176k times 27 Pseudo Code: int arr [ 5 ] = { 4, 1, 3, 2, 6 }, x; x = find (3).arr ; x would then return 2. c++ arrays ShareIn today’s digital age, gaming has become more accessible than ever before. With a vast array of options available, it can be overwhelming to decide between online free games or paid options.Aug 8, 2016 at 9:22. Add a comment. 33. The typical formula for recalculation of 2D array indices into 1D array index is. index = indexX * arrayWidth + indexY; Alternatively you can use. index = indexY * arrayHeight + indexX; (assuming that arrayWidth is measured along X axis, and arrayHeight along Y axis)Stack Overflow, I got used to the idea that enum class values are not meant to be used directly as indices. Static-casting is an option, so one could quickly make an utility such as: enum class binary : bool { first = 0, second = 1 }; template<size_t size> constexpr int at (std::array<int, size> const& arr, binary idx) { return arr [static_cast ...Initialization from strings. String literal (optionally enclosed in braces) may be used as the initializer for an array of matching type: . ordinary string literals and UTF-8 string literals (since C11) can initialize arrays of any character type (char, signed char, unsigned char) ; L-prefixed wide string literals can be used to initialize arrays of any type compatible with (ignoring cv ...Array index in your context (array bound is not known) is exactly identical to the pointer operation. From a viewpoint of compilers, it is just different expression of pointer arithmetic. Here is an example of an optimized x86 code in Visual Studio 2010 with full optimization and no inline. Building on the other responses, another alternative is a simple templated class that wraps a c-style array. With the EnumArray example below, any enum class with a kMaxValue can be used as the index. In my opinion, the improved readability is worth the introduction of a template.If you’re planning an event or gathering and want to treat your guests to an authentic Italian dining experience, look no further than Olive Garden’s catering menu. With a delectable selection of dishes, Olive Garden offers a variety of opt...Accessing Elements of Two-Dimensional Arrays in C. Elements in 2D arrays are accessed using row indexes and column indexes. Each element in a 2D array can be referred to by: Syntax: array_name[i][j] where, i: The row index. j: The column index. Example: int x[2][1]; The above example represents the element present in the third row …The index found in a book is a list of the topics, names and places mentioned in it, together with the page numbers where they can be found. The index is usually found at the back of a book.Array indexes start with 0: [0] is the first element. [1] is the second element, etc. This statement accesses the value of the first element [0] in myNumbers: Example int myNumbers [] = {25, 50, 75, 100}; printf ("%d", myNumbers [0]); // Outputs 25 Try it Yourself » Change an Array ElementAll Qt C++ Classes All QML Types All Qt Modules All Qt Reference Pages Getting Started Introduction to Qt Getting Started Examples and Tutorials Supported Platforms What's new in Qt 6 Qt Licensing Overviews Development Tools User Interfaces Core Internals Data Input Output Networking and Connectivity3. Using std::find_if algorithm. Sometimes it is desired to search for an element that meets certain conditions in the array. For instance, find the index of the first 2-digit number in the array. The recommended approach is to use the std::find_if algorithm, which accepts a predicate to handle such cases. 1.Access Array Elements. Array indexing is the same as accessing an array element. You can access an array element by referring to its index number. The indexes in NumPy arrays start with 0, meaning that the first element has index 0, and the second has index 1 etc.Dec 5, 2021 · This post provides an overview of available methods to find an index of the first occurrence of an element in the array in C++. 1. Naive solution. A simple solution is …Feb 22, 2012 · int arr[] = new int[15]; The variable arr holds a memory address. At the memory address, there are 15 consecutive ints in a row. They can be referenced with index 0 to 14 inclusive. ndarrays can be indexed using the standard Python x [obj] syntax, where x is the array and obj the selection. There are different kinds of indexing available depending on obj : basic indexing, advanced indexing and field access. Most of the following examples show the use of indexing when referencing data in an array.Oct 30, 2014 · Type for array indices: signed/unsigned integer avantages. In C++, the default size for array indices is size_t which is a 64 bits unsigned 64-bits integer on most x86-64 platforms. I am in the process of building my own std::vector class for my library for High Performance Computing (One of the main reason is that I want this class to be able ... Feb 27, 2018 · vector 模板类vector类似于string类,也是一种动态数组.可以在运行阶段设置vector对象的长度,可在末尾附加新数据,还可以在中间插入新数据.它是new创建动态数组 …Jun 2, 2023 · If any element is found equal to the key, the search is successful and the index of that element is returned. If no element is found equal to the key, the search yields “No match found”. For example: Consider the array arr [] = {10, 50, 30, 70, 80, 20, 90, 40} and key = 30. Step 1: Start from the first element (index 0) and compare key with ... c++ - How do I find a particular value in an array and return its index? - Stack Overflow How do I find a particular value in an array and return its index? Ask Question Asked 13 years ago Modified 8 months ago Viewed 176k times 27 Pseudo Code: int arr [ 5 ] = { 4, 1, 3, 2, 6 }, x; x = find (3).arr ; x would then return 2. c++ arrays ShareTo me, it makes perfect sense: the array index is the difference from the origin pointer. Some have also said that size_t is right because that is designed to hold the size. However, as some have commented: this is the size in bytes, and so can generally hold values several times greater than the maximum possible array index.3 ก.ย. 2562 ... C++ arrays are often used to organize and track data. ... A is the name of the array which consists of three elements. The first element's index ...The Dawes Roll Index is a vital resource for individuals interested in tracing their Native American ancestry. Created in the late 19th century, this index documents the enrollment of members of the Cherokee, Choctaw, Creek, Chickasaw, and ...But for compiler type of as an array is int[2] and type of b as an array is int[3] which are completely different from each other. Again just the compiler’s perspective. For better understanding let the two arrays be int a[2], int b[3].6. There is no functional difference I know of but the form myPointer [1] is ultimately more readable and far less likely to incur coding errors. DC. The form * (myPointer + 1) does not allow for changing the type of pointer to an object and therefore getting access to the overloaded [] operator. The New York Marriage Index is a valuable resource for individuals looking to research their family history or gather information about marriages that have taken place in the state.When it comes to sharing files on BitTorrent and Usenet, it doesn’t get any better than private trackers and indexers. But by definition, they’re very exclusive, so you can’t just waltz in the front door. Here’s how to get access to the bes...C++ get index of element of array by value. 1. C++ finding num of elements in a char* array. 0. How to get the actual Value at a specific index of a char array. 0.Jul 24, 2014 · array. circular-list. or ask your own question. The problem: Treat an array as if it is circular; out-of-bounds indices "wrap around" the array to become in-bounds. Current solution: // roudedArray.cpp #include <iostream> template <. There's now a great way of doing this called findIndex which takes a function that return true/false based on whether the array element matches (as always, check for browser compatibility though). var index = peoples.findIndex(function(person) { return person.attr1 == "john" }); With ES6 syntax you get to write this:Oct 9, 2023 · C++ Containers library std::array std::array is a container that encapsulates fixed size arrays. This container is an aggregate type with the same semantics as a …index in c programming Ask Question Asked 10 years, 9 months ago Modified 10 years, 9 months ago Viewed 12k times 1 I have a question about locating an index. suppose I have a "relative" index in an array (that was allocated with malloc), or basically an index that doesn't tell me where I am really. how can I find the "absolute" index?16 ก.พ. 2566 ... Now it is time to print all the array elements (the value that each index of the array has) in the given order. ... C++ (or whatever programming ...Sep 6, 2011 · Quote from the C standard, (C18), 6.3.2.1/4: "Except when it is the operand of the sizeof operator, or the unary & operator, or is a string literal used to initialize an array, an expression that has type "array of type" is converted to an expression with type "pointer to type" that points to the initial element of the array object and is not an lvalue. As for the edit to your question, basically all that std::begin and std::end do in the case of arrays is convert to a pointer. std::begin will simply return the array decayed to a pointer, i.e. a pointer to the first element and std::end will …2 ส.ค. 2553 ... It is perfectly ok to use char variable as an index to an array -- in fact it is very handy thing to do at times. For example lets say you need ...c++ - How do I find a particular value in an array and return its index? - Stack Overflow How do I find a particular value in an array and return its index? Ask Question Asked 13 years ago Modified 8 months ago Viewed 176k times 27 Pseudo Code: int arr [ 5 ] = { 4, 1, 3, 2, 6 }, x; x = find (3).arr ; x would then return 2. c++ arrays ShareSep 1, 2018 · 详解C语言中index()函数和rindex()函数的用法C语言index()函数:查找字符串并返回首次出现的位置相关函数:rindex, srechr, strrchr头文件:#include 定义函 …VERY IMPORTANT: Array indices start at zero in C, and go to one less than the size of the array. For example, a five element array will have indices zero through four. This is because the index in C is actually an offset from the beginning of the array. ( The first element is at the beginning of the array, and hence has zero offset.For example, I am setting only array index arr[0], arr[8] ... In this article, we learned how we could initialize a C array, using different methods.Returns a reference to the array element at specified location idx, with bounds checking.; Returns a reference to the object element with specified key key, with bounds checking.; See 2. This overload is only available if KeyType is comparable with typename object_t:: key_type and typename object_comparator_t:: is_transparent denotes a type.; …Exceeding the bounds of the array means that you would be accessing memory that is not assigned to the array. This means: This memory can have any value. There's no way of knowing if the data is valid based on your data type. This memory may contain sensitive information such as private keys or other user credentials.Type for array indices: signed/unsigned integer avantages. In C++, the default size for array indices is size_t which is a 64 bits unsigned 64-bits integer on most x86-64 platforms. I am in the process of building my own std::vector class for my library for High Performance Computing (One of the main reason is that I want this class to be able ...Arrays are used to store multiple values in a single variable, instead of declaring separate variables for each value. To create an array, define the data type (like int) and specify the name of the array followed by square brackets [] . To insert values to it, use a comma-separated list, inside curly braces: We have now created a variable that ...You can access elements of an array by indices. Suppose you declared an array mark as above. The first element is mark [0], the second element is mark [1] and so on. Declare an Array Few keynotes: Arrays have 0 as the first index, not 1. In this example, mark [0] is the first element.Sum of consecutive two elements in a array; Find start and ending index of an element in an unsorted array; Sum of even numbers at even position; Longest Subarray of non-negative Integers; Find an element in an array such that elements form a strictly decreasing and increasing sequence; Average numbers in array; Mean of array using …1. I was reading through a C program which interfaces with hardware registers. The person has been using hexadecimal numbers as the index to an array such as : app_base_add [0x30] I know that a [i] means * (a+i) which is * (a+ (i*sizeof ( typeof (a)))) so a hexadecimal index is probably a offset of the desired memory location in the address ...Jul 4, 2010 · To me, it makes perfect sense: the array index is the difference from the origin pointer. Some have also said that size_t is right because that is designed to hold the size. However, as some have commented: this is the size in bytes, and so can generally hold values several times greater than the maximum possible array index. A Dynamic array ( vector in C++, ArrayList in Java) automatically grows when we try to make an insertion and there is no more space left for the new item. Usually the area doubles in size. A simple dynamic array can be constructed by allocating an array of fixed-size, typically larger than the number of elements immediately required.Accessing Elements of Two-Dimensional Arrays in C. Elements in 2D arrays are accessed using row indexes and column indexes. Each element in a 2D array can be referred to by: Syntax: array_name[i][j] where, i: The row index. j: The column index. Example: int x[2][1]; The above example represents the element present in the third row …Keep in mind that the array always starts from the 0 index (th, Aug 23, 2023 · An array in C is a fixed-size collection of similar data items stored in, The following example shows how to declare a private array field, temps, and an indexer. The indexer enables direct, If any element is found equal to the key, the search, # what type can/should be used as array index? # # eg. can i use unsigned long? or should it be size_, // syntax to access array elements array[index]; Consider the array x we h, Predictive Index scoring is the result of a test that measures a work-related personality. The Predictive I, An index contour is one of the ways that vertical dimension, or ve, Exceeding the bounds of the array means that you would be, A Dynamic array ( vector in C++, ArrayList in Java) automatically , Arrays in C act to store related data under a single v, FindIndex<T> (T [], Int32, Predicate<T>, A single-dimensional array is a sequence of like elements. Yo, Nov 8, 2021 · To use the System.Index type as an argumen, Indexing of an array starts from 0. It means the first element i, Mar 1, 2021 · 1 Answer. C# 8.0 and going forward,, Add a comment. 2. Arrays in C++ and C are zero indexed, meaning the, An array is a series of elements of the same type placed .